    Insurance Coverage for IVF

    Unfortunately, not all insurance plans cover IVF, and those that do may have limited coverage. In the United States, only 17 states have laws that mandate some form of coverage for infertility treatments, including IVF. This means that the majority of couples have to pay for IVF out of pocket or find alternative ways to fund their treatment.

    In-Network vs. Out-of-Network Clinics

    Most insurance plans have a network of providers that they work with, which can include IVF clinics. In-network clinics have negotiated rates with insurance companies, which means that they are more affordable for patients. On the other hand, out-of-network clinics have not negotiated rates, and patients may have to pay more out of pocket.

    The advantage of choosing an in-network clinic is that the cost of IVF treatment is significantly reduced. This makes it a more feasible option for couples with limited financial resources. In contrast, out-of-network clinics may offer more specialized services or have a higher success rate, but the cost can be a major barrier for couples.

    1. Age:

    One of the most crucial factors that can affect IVF success rates is the age of the woman. As a woman gets older, her ovarian reserve and egg quality decline, making it more difficult to achieve pregnancy through IVF. According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), the success rate for women under 35 is around 40%, while it drops to 31% for women aged 35-37 and 22% for women aged 38-40. For women over 40, the success rate drops significantly to only 13%.

    2. Underlying Medical Conditions:

    Certain medical conditions can also impact the success rates of IVF. For example, women with endometriosis, pol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S), or uterine fibroids may have a lower chance of success with IVF. These conditions can affect the quality and quantity of eggs, as well as the receptiveness of the uterus for implantation.

    3. Previous Pregnancy History:

    The success rates of IVF can also be affected by a woman’s previous pregnancy history. If a woman has had a successful pregnancy in the past through IVF, she may have a higher chance of success in subsequent IVF cycles. On the other hand, women who have had multiple failed IVF cycles may have a lower chance of success in future cycles.

    4. Sperm Quality:

    While IVF is often seen as a solution for female infertility, the quality of the male partner’s sperm can also impact the success rates of IVF. Poor sperm quality can make it more difficult to fertilize the egg, resulting in lower success rates. Therefore, it is important for both partners to undergo fertility testing before undergoing IVF.

    5. Lifestyle Factors:

    Lifestyle factors such as smoking, excessive alcohol consumption, and obesity can also impact the success rates of IVF. These factors can affect the quality of eggs and sperm, as well as the overall health and well-being of the couple. It is important for couples to adopt healthy lifestyles before undergoing IVF to increase their chances of success.

    Understanding Donor Egg IVF

    Donor egg IVF is a type of assisted reproductive technology (ART) that involves using a donated egg from a fertile woman to create an embryo and implant it into the uterus of the intended mother or a gestational carrier. This process is commonly used by couples who are unable to conceive due to issues with egg quality or quantity, same-sex couples, and single individuals. Donor egg IVF has a high success rate and has helped many individuals and couples fulfill their dream of having a child.

    The Process of Donor Egg IVF

    The process of donor egg IVF involves several steps and requires the coordination of multiple parties. First, the intended parents must choose an egg donor through a donor agency or a fertility clinic. The chosen donor will undergo a thorough screening process, including medical and genetic testing, to ensure they are healthy and free of any hereditary diseases.

    Once an egg donor is selected, the donor will undergo ovarian stimulation to produce multiple eggs. The eggs will then be retrieved and fertilized with the intended father’s sperm or donor sperm in a laboratory. The resulting embryos will be cultured in a lab for a few days before being transferred into the uterus of the intended mother or gestational carrier. Any remaining viable embryos may be frozen for future use.
